good places for people who can't eat solid food?

preferably in union square/nob hill/soma area, etc...

ideally lookign for things like pureed soups, etc...

      San Francisco Soup Company, Jamba Juice and all varieties of frozen yogurt, ice cream and milk shakes were my (unexciting) go-tos during a long period of a soft food diet. I also found I was often able to eat hummus, well-cooked beans, and the like, and had some success with Middle Eastern food.
